An Efficient and Adaptive Decentralized File Replication Algorithm in P2P File Sharing Systems

被引:34
|
作者
Shen, Haiying [1 ]
机构
[1] Clemson Univ, Holcombe Dept Elect & Comp Engn, Clemson, SC 29634 USA
基金
美国国家科学基金会;
关键词
Peer-to-peer system; distributed hash table; file sharing system; file replication;
D O I
10.1109/TPDS.2009.127
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
In peer-to-peer file sharing systems, file replication technology is widely used to reduce hot spots and improve file query efficiency. Most current file replication methods replicate files in all nodes or two end points on a client-server query path. However, these methods either have low effectiveness or come at a cost of high overhead. File replication in server side enhances replica hit rate, hence, lookup efficiency but produces overloaded nodes and cannot significantly reduce query path length. File replication in client side could greatly reduce query path length, but cannot guarantee high replica hit rate to fully utilize replicas. Though replication along query path solves these problems, it comes at a high cost of overhead due to more replicas and produces underutilized replicas. This paper presents an Efficient and Adaptive Decentralized (EAD) file replication algorithm that achieves high query efficiency and high replica utilization at a significantly low cost. EAD enhances the utilization of file replicas by selecting query traffic hubs and frequent requesters as replica nodes, and dynamically adapting to nonuniform and time-varying file popularity and node interest. Unlike current methods, EAD creates and deletes replicas in a decentralized self-adaptive manner while guarantees high replica utilization. Theoretical analysis shows the high performance of EAD. Simulation results demonstrate the efficiency and effectiveness of EAD in comparison with other approaches in both static and dynamic environments. It dramatically reduces the overhead of file replication, and yields significant improvements on the efficiency and effectiveness of file replication in terms of query efficiency, replica hit rate, and overloaded nodes reduction.
引用
收藏
页码:827 / 840
页数:14
相关论文
共 50 条
  • [1] EAD: An Efficient and Adaptive Decentralized File Replication Algorithm in P2P File Sharing Systems
    Shen, Haiying
    [J]. P2P'08: EIGHTH INTERNATIONAL CONFERENCE ON PEER-TO-PEER COMPUTING, PROCEEDINGS, 2008, : 99 - 108
  • [2] Efficient and Effective File Replication in Structured P2P File Sharing Systems
    Shen, Haiying
    [J]. 2009 IEEE NINTH INTERNATIONAL CONFERENCE ON PEER-TO-PEER COMPUTING (P2P 2009), 2009, : 159 - 162
  • [3] A decentralized incentive mechanism for P2P file sharing systems
    Jie Zhang
    Zheng Zhao
    Yi Gong
    Maode Ma
    [J]. 2007 6TH INTERNATIONAL CONFERENCE ON INFORMATION, COMMUNICATIONS & SIGNAL PROCESSING, VOLS 1-4, 2007, : 160 - +
  • [4] An efficient source peer selection algorithm in hybrid P2P file sharing systems
    Li, Jingyuan
    Jia, Weijia
    Huang, Liusheng
    Xiao, Mingjun
    Wang, Jun
    [J]. ALGORITHMS AND ARCHITECTURES FOR PARALLEL PROCESSING, PROCEEDINGS, 2007, 4494 : 380 - +
  • [5] Swarm Intelligence Based File Replication and Consistency Maintenance in Structured P2P File Sharing Systems
    Shen, Haiying
    Liu, Guoxin
    Chandler, Harrison
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2015, 64 (10) : 2953 - 2967
  • [6] Pollution in P2P file sharing systems
    Liang, J
    Kumar, R
    Xi, YJ
    Ross, KW
    [J]. IEEE INFOCOM 2005: THE CONFERENCE ON COMPUTER COMMUNICATIONS, VOLS 1-4, PROCEEDINGS, 2005, : 1174 - 1185
  • [7] Maximizing P2P File Access Availability in Mobile AdHoc Networks though Replication for Efficient File Sharing
    Pirjade, Shabana
    Burghate, Rakhi R.
    Ghogare, Prachi G.
    Ghotkule, Ashwini
    Jatade, Jyoti
    [J]. PROCEEDINGS OF THE 2ND INTERNATIONAL CONFERENCE ON INVENTIVE SYSTEMS AND CONTROL (ICISC 2018), 2018, : 1434 - 1438
  • [8] Efficient file sharing strategy in DHT based P2P systems
    Xu, ZY
    He, XB
    Bhuyan, L
    [J]. CONFERENCE PROCEEDINGS OF THE 2005 IEEE INTERNATIONAL PERFORMANCE, COMPUTING AND COMMUNICATIONS CONFERENCE, 2005, : 151 - 158
  • [9] Efficient Multipoint P2P File Sharing in MANETs
    Mawji, Afzal
    Hassanein, Hossam
    [J]. GLOBECOM 2009 - 2009 IEEE GLOBAL TELECOMMUNICATIONS CONFERENCE, VOLS 1-8, 2009, : 1253 - 1258
  • [10] Efficient Search in P2P File Sharing System
    肖波
    靳桅
    侯孟书
    [J]. Railway Engineering Science, 2006, (01) : 29 - 33